About This Home

Available Now

Charming and rarely available four-level home in the heart of Arlington, offering 5 bedrooms and 4.5 baths, built in 1989. Hardwood floors span the entire main level, creating a warm and inviting living space 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. The home is perfectly located just minutes from Ballston and Clarendon, with easy access to popular restaurants, shops, and commuter routes. The spacious primary suite features a vaulted ceiling and sliding glass doors leading to a second-level porch that overlooks the large, private yard. In addition to the primary suite, there are four additional bedrooms, one of which could serve as a second primary bedroom. With abundant storage throughout, a convenient laundry room on the lower level and a flexible four-level layout, this home offers both comfort and functionality in a highly sought-after location.

City - Arlington

Directly across the Potomac River from Washington, D.C., Arlington is less a suburb than an extension of the nation’s capital. It’s the home of the Pentagon, Arlington National Cemetery, and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, with a number of waterfront parks offering beautiful views across the river to the National Mall.

The community provides a wide range of living options, from apartments, townhomes, and duplexes to condos and houses. A major reason for Arlington’s popularity is that there is so much to do. Washington may be packed with monuments, museums, and other sightseeing landmarks, but Arlington holds the advantage when it comes to the more day-to-day shopping, dining, entertainment, and nightlife.

You’ll have several options for getting around town or into D.C., whether you choose to drive, take the Metro, or ride your bike — Arlington has earned a silver rating from the League of American Bicyclists.
